Saga Net Revenue Up 4.7% In Q4
On Tuesday Saga Communications reported a net revenue increase of 4.7% to $32.9 million for the quarter ended December 31, 2018. On a same-station basis for the 12 months ended December 31, 2018, net revenue increased 1.1% to $116.5 million.
Salem Q4 Revenue Up Slightly
On a busy earnings day, Salem was the final company to report Tuesday with same station net broadcast revenue increasing 1.9% to $50.3 million from $49.3 million in Q4 of 2017. Digital revenue increased 4% to $11.5 million from $11.1 million.
Beasley Gives Dunn Another Market
Beasley has promoted Kent Dunn to the position of Regional VP for Augusta and Fayetteville. Dunn has been overseeing the company’s cluster in Augusta. He replaces Erika Beasley who was running the Fayetteville cluster and is now Corporate Digital Content Director for Local Markets
Stevens Now Region SVP, iHeart Atlanta
Kudos to Meg Stevens who has been named Region Senior Vice President of Programming for iHeart's Atlanta Region. Stevens joins the Atlanta Region from WKKT 96.9 The Kat.

Alessandra Alarcón Assumes Key Role At SBS
Alessandra Alarcón has been appointed President of SBS Entertainment as the company celebrates 35 years of operation. She became the sole producer of the Calibash event in Los Angeles in 2017, after joining SBS in 2014 as a Sales Associate.
